#e4edce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e4edce is composed of 89.4% red, 92.9% green and 80.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 3.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 13.1% yellow and 7.1% black. It has a hue angle of 77.4 degrees, a saturation of 46.3% and a lightness of 86.9%. #e4edce color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c9db9d.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

● #e4edce color description : Light grayish green.
#e4edce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e4edce has RGB values of R:228, G:237, B:206 and CMYK values of C:0.04, M:0, Y:0.13, K:0.07. Its decimal value is 15003086.
